What are part time insurance jobs?

Part time insurance jobs are positions within the insurance industry that require employees to work fewer hours than a typical full-time schedule, often under 30-35 hours per week. These roles can include sales agents, customer service representatives, claims processors, or administrative support staff. Part time insurance jobs offer flexible schedules and can be a good fit for students, retirees, or those seeking supplemental income. They may provide opportunities to gain industry experience and, in some cases, offer benefits such as training or commissions.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a part time insurance agent?

To thrive as a Part Time Insurance Agent, you generally need a high school diploma or equivalent, state insurance licensure, and a solid understanding of insurance products and sales principles. Familiarity with customer relationship management (CRM) software, quoting systems, and underwriting tools is typically required. Outstanding interpersonal skills, self-motivation, and the ability to build trust with clients help set top performers apart. These skills are crucial for effectively identifying client needs, providing suitable coverage solutions, and achieving sales targets in a flexible, part-time role.

What are some common challenges faced by part time insurance agents and how can they be managed?

Part-time insurance agents often face challenges such as balancing client outreach with limited working hours and building a consistent client base. Managing time efficiently and leveraging digital tools for communication and client management can help maximize productivity. Additionally, staying up-to-date with product knowledge and maintaining strong relationships with full-time colleagues ensures better collaboration and support. Networking and ongoing training are also key to successfully growing in this flexible role.

What is the difference between Part Time Insurance vs Part Time Insurance Agent?

AspectPart Time InsurancePart Time Insurance Agent
CredentialsNone required or minimal licensingState licensing and certifications often required
Work EnvironmentVaries; may include administrative or customer service rolesSales-focused, client-facing roles
Employer & Industry UsageInsurance companies, brokers, or agenciesInsurance agencies, brokerages, or direct insurers
Search & Comparison IntentUnderstanding part-time roles in insuranceSeeking sales or agent-specific part-time opportunities

Part Time Insurance generally refers to roles within the insurance industry that require minimal licensing or credentials, often involving administrative or customer service tasks. In contrast, a Part Time Insurance Agent specifically involves sales and client interaction, requiring licensing and certifications. Both roles are common in insurance companies and agencies, but they serve different functions and skill sets.
